I see that there has been some discussion earlier about the use of
milter-sender with sendmail to verify that the sender's address does exist
before accepting mail.  That then allows mail to be rejected at connection
time if the sender's address seems to be fraudulent.

I like the idea behind milter-sender, but would much prefer it to be
integrated with MailScanner rather than sendmail, so that false positives
(eg no-reply type addresses and other mail blocked due to problems that
are sure to arise) result in mail being quarantined rather than bounced.
Is this an option that you would be interested in accepting on the
wishlist for future development of MailScanner?
